Scanning New Discs
When loading discs to the Changer/Recorder, the discs must be
identified, scanned, and categorized by Media Center to update
your media library before viewing in
My Changer
. After new discs
are loaded, do the following.
1 Start Media Center.
2 From the Start menu, select
More Programs
and then select
Manage Discs
. The Found New Discs message appears on
screen.
3 Click
Yes
to begin scanning the discs to update your media library
with new disc information. It can take up to 60 seconds to scan
each disc. Once the discs have been identified and scanned, they
can be viewed in
My Changer
.
Important Notes
• If you have multiple user accounts setup on the host computer,
the metadata for audio CDs will display only for the user
account that was logged on at the time the discs were originally
scanned. For other user accounts to view audio CD metadata,
they must unload the discs from the changer, log on to the new
account, and then reload and rescan the audio CDs again.
•
My Changer Music
(Sony
®
Changer/Recorder) and
My Music
(Media Center) are distinct areas in your entertainment system
and offer separate features.
My Changer Music
does not dis-
play music discs or files that have been copied to the
My Music
or
Shared Music
folders on the hard disk drive. The only Media
Changer/Recorder audio CD available in
My Music
is the cur-
rent disc in the Changer’s drive.
Note
: You must have a working Internet connection to download
metadata content to properly recognize the discs and associate
the applicable metadata for each disc.
Note
: DVD media can also be identified, scanned, and
categorized by selecting
My DVDs
from the Media Center Start
menu.
